In the realm of electronics and communication systems, the term heterodyne oscillator refers to a crucial component that plays a significant role in signal processing. A heterodyne oscillator is an electronic circuit that generates a frequency signal that is a combination of two different frequencies. This process is fundamental in applications such as radio communications, where it allows for the mixing of signals to produce new frequencies that can be more easily transmitted or processed. The basic principle behind a heterodyne oscillator involves the use of two oscillators: one that produces a stable reference frequency and another that produces a variable frequency. When these two frequencies are mixed, they create sum and difference frequencies, which are essential for modulation and demodulation processes in communication systems.The operation of a heterodyne oscillator can be understood through its application in radio receivers. When a radio signal is received, it is often at a very high frequency, making it difficult to process directly. By using a heterodyne oscillator, the received signal is mixed with a local oscillator signal, resulting in an intermediate frequency (IF) that is lower and easier to manage. This technique not only simplifies the design of receivers but also improves selectivity and sensitivity, allowing for clearer reception of desired signals while filtering out unwanted noise.Moreover, the versatility of the heterodyne oscillator extends beyond just radio receivers. It is also utilized in various other fields such as radar systems, optical communication, and even in scientific research where precise frequency generation is required. For instance, in laser technology, a heterodyne oscillator can help in measuring small frequency shifts that occur due to the Doppler effect, providing valuable information about the motion of objects.One of the key advantages of using a heterodyne oscillator is its ability to achieve high frequency stability and accuracy. This is particularly important in applications where precision is critical, such as in telecommunications and navigation systems. By carefully designing the components of a heterodyne oscillator, engineers can minimize phase noise and enhance the overall performance of the system.However, there are also challenges associated with heterodyne oscillators. The complexity of the circuitry can lead to issues such as distortion and interference, which must be carefully managed to ensure reliable operation.
